The free cooling system is, using mostly in service and technology sectors; for internal air cooling. It is an energy-saving and environmentally-friendly product.
The free cooling system, throws away the warm air to outside of the system room; instead of cooling it by air-conditioner.
As a support of existing air-conditioning systems; The free-cooling system provides significant energy savings.
By this way, it pays itself, in a very short time.
Electricity bills, one of the key costs of the enterprise.
The system pays for itself by energy-saving, its investment costs for a very short time.
The free-cooling system, in the fall, winter and spring, provides maximum savings.
In addition to reducing the use of air-conditioning system with ozone friendly to nature, does not contain gas.
Indoor and outdoor temperature is constantly monitored.
When internal ambient temperature reaches a certain value, the fan starts running.
The fan throws out the warm air from inside of the system room to outside, and gets the cool air inside.
Thus, the free circulation of cool air is provided.
When the internal temperature of the environment reaches the desired value, Fan will be stopped.
Fan does not run when the air conditioner operates till getting the internal environment to the desired level.
The air conditioner stops when the temperature is reached.

Example: A Base Station Power Consumption for Cooling
Max. Power = 2kWh
For the winter time,A/C power consumption:12 hours x 2000 W = 24kWh
Power consumption of FCS120C/D:24 hours x 125 W = 3 Kwh
Power consumption of FCS190C/D:24 hours X 197 W = 4,8 Kwh
Saving 19~21 Kwh per day
During a 20-day study;
Fan (FCS55D: 55 W fan) 380 hours,
Air-Conditioner 19 hours worked.
